Essay questions
These essay questions are meant to be used as a starting point for your essay or research paper.
- Discuss the role of assimilation in 'The Rise of David Levinsky'. How does Levinsky's journey from a Jewish immigrant to a successful businessman reflect the theme of assimilation?
- Analyze the character of David Levinsky. How does his ambition drive his actions and shape his relationships throughout the novel?
- Examine the role of religion in 'The Rise of David Levinsky'. How does Levinsky's struggle with his Jewish faith impact his identity and choices?
- Explore the theme of identity in the novel. How does Levinsky's search for success and acceptance in American society influence his sense of self?
- Discuss the portrayal of gender roles in 'The Rise of David Levinsky'. How do female characters like Genya and Mamie influence Levinsky's understanding of masculinity?
- Analyze the significance of the title 'The Rise of David Levinsky'. How does Levinsky's journey from poverty to wealth reflect the larger narrative of Jewish immigrants in America?
- Examine the theme of loneliness in the novel. How does Levinsky's pursuit of success and wealth isolate him from meaningful connections?
- Discuss the role of the American Dream in 'The Rise of David Levinsky'. How does Levinsky's pursuit of material success align with or deviate from the traditional ideals of the American Dream?
